The Spinach (Spinacia oleracea) is an annual plant which botanically belongs to the family of Chenopodiaceae. The Geant d'Hiver variety is extremely productive, very resistant to cold, and sensitive to high temperatures. It yields more in fertile soils. Its leaves are large, and their color is deep green. The organically produced Spinach Geant d'Hiver comes from the renowned French seed company VILMORIN (founded in 1743), which guarantees the organic origin of the seed, germination and fidelity to the variety of the product.
Spinach plants can be co-cultivated with Lettuce, Bean, Celery, and Strawberry plants.

Additional Features | Spinach is sown from early to mid-Spring under cover and directly in permanent positions from early to mid-Autumn. It is harvested from April to June and from October to November. |
Use of Product | Spinach is suitable for fresh consumption in salads, or added to cooked foods. |
